    August 25, 2017 Foxtel Partners With Brightcove to Live Stream Mayweather-McGregor Main Event Biggest boxing bout of the year to be available to non-Foxtel subscribers SYDNEY--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Ahead of the biggest boxing bout of the year and one of the most anticipated fights in the history of the sport, Foxtel has partnered with Brightcove Inc. (NASDAQ: BCOV), the leading provider of cloud services for video, to livestream the Floyd Mayweather vs. Conor McGregor fight on August 27 (AEST). In addition to being able to watch the Pay-Per-View event at home, or at licensed venues, all Australian viewers can also subscribe to and stream the fight online. The offering will complement Foxtel's existing Main Event service available over cable/satellite and in licensed venues. The announcement follows a soft launch of the online offering last month, with Foxtel live streaming Jeff Horn's victory match over Manny Pacquiao to thousands of Australians. Ed Follows, Director of Product Technology Development at Foxtel, commented, "In recent years, we've focused our efforts on finding new ways to increase customer choices, and effortlessly give customers access to our content. This is another way we're doing just that. Previously, Main Event content like this has only been available to Foxtel customers. But with the dedicated online experience, anyone can sign up, buy a ticket and immediately watch the fight, with no ongoing subscription required. It means more Australians can subscribe to ground-breaking bouts like this than ever before." "Brightcove has been a fantastic partner, managing the entire process and bringing some key partners into the mix that make this all possible," Follows said.

    CRITICAL INFORMATION SUMMARY – FOXTEL FROM SIMPLE INFORMATION ABOUT THE SERVICE Foxtel from Simple service allows you to view a selection of Foxtel channels within your chosen package. It is specially designed for independent living seniors, offering more of what you want, and less of what you don’t need. Where is this plan availaBle? • Foxtel from Simple is available at a growing number of Retire Australia villages. Visit our website at www.rasimple.com.au for an up to date list. Set Top Box and Installation • You will require a Foxtel from Simple set top box for you service. • A standard installation and equipment fee of $150 applies for each outlet in your home. This covers a standard installation and the cost of a Foxtel iQ2 HD or MyStarHD recordable set top box. This fee is waived only for existing Foxtel Residential Customers with an active service at the service address (excludes Foxtel on T-Box and Foxtel from Telstra), however you continue to use the set top box you currently use. • Additional costs may apply for non-standard installations, such as installations that are complex or in remote areas. What is the minimum contract period? Minimum Contract Period 12 months Your minimum term will commence on the date of the Foxtel service activation. This date may be different from other Simple services you may have which are installed or activated separately. Cancel Fee If you cancel early, you pay a cancel fee equal to the total monthly recurring charges for the remaining term of the Minimum Contract Period. If you are leaving the Village, you can cancel and no cancel fee applies.
